Title

DESIGN OF HIGH SECURITY BASED DATA TRANSFER SYSTEM BY USING CRYPTOGRAPHY ALGORITHM

Abstract

Data security upgrade utilizing the multilayer linear feedback shift register (LFSR) cryptographic procedure to beat the issue of data hacking. The data security is accomplished with a One Time Pad (OTP) calculation created in multilayer which characterizes the sign transmission in the medium. The Pseudorandom Noise (PN) succession made by the primitive polynomial is utilized to get the seed esteems that are utilized to portray OTP usefulness. The single-layered LFSR cryptography is examined with a fell LFSR cryptography strategy to demonstrate the security of digitized data. The authentication key generation circuits for different degrees of bit dealing with in data correspondence frameworks are carried out in LFSR cascaded cryptography in both encryption and decryption measure.
